Explain how you responded to a significant challenge that you have encountered and what you learned in the process. (maximum 200 words) A significantchallenge that I had encountered was the need to retain my full-time status as a student and maintain exemplary academic performance to be considered for John Abbotts Student Involvement Recognition (SIR) program. The primary challenge was in time management. I endeavored to improve my capabilities through the SIR program by being immersed to diverse managing situations within a maximized time frame.

Concurrently, I joined many in-college clubs such as the Green Giants, and the Pennies for Poultry. I was actively present in most of their weekly meetings and participated in brainstorming activities. I was especially enthusiastic about joining varied extra-curricular events which took place within my institution. These activities included becoming a career fair host and volunteering in fundraising. The fundraising activity was most memorable since the end result was the generation of hundreds of dollars for programs and projects to be earmarked in Africa.

Through many of our innovative initiatives, program participants helped in making John Abbott more sustainable and be recognized as a social responsible organization. I learned to be academically, socially and environmentally responsible; I developed effective techniques for time management; and gained advanced knowledge in applying business theories into effective practice.Tell us more about one of the activities you listed above, explaining what your goals were, what you did to pursue them, the results achieved, and what you learned in the process.

(maximum 200 words) This semester I wanted to be more focused on academic performance and in activities that are considered productive and beneficial to a greater number of people. I aimed to maximize my potentials for learning; while still be able to help others within my spare time. Hence, I became a Volunteer Coordinator for Charity Haunt Productions. My objective was to give back to the community by helping them make their event a success through professional inputs and assisting in coordinating with different agencies.

I likewise provided much needed assistance in terms of the development of correspondences for program communication, promoting teamwork, applying leadership and management skills in areas most needed. I managed to achieve my goals by being more open-minded to constructive criticism by the teenagers and managers alike; by adapting to required changes; and through great time management (despite taking a full course load). The end result was that I became a better communicator, a more effective team player, and a responsible and mature leader.

Throughout the process, I have learned that managing kids and teenagers is not the same as dealing with adults. I had to use a more appropriate approach to cater to their distinct and specialized needs.
